Jane Powell was singing and dancing at an early age. She sang on the radio and performed in theaters before her screen debut in 1944. Attended Agnes Peters Dancing School as a child in Portland, Oregon.
Birth Name Suzanne Lorraine Burce The character she played in her first movie, Song of the Open Road (1944) was named Jane Powell. MGM gave her the name of the character she played for her own stage moniker. Song of the Open Road (1944) Child film star Jane Powell, fed up with her every move being stage managed by her stage mother, runs away and joins the U.S. Crop Corps, a small army of young folks staying at youth hostels and picking crops while adult farmworkers are at war. Totally clueless about the real world, befuddled Jane is embroiled in teen-romance complications while Mother frantically searches. Will her stardom help or hinder her new friends? W.C. Fields does a short act with Bergen and McCarthy.
